Understanding the Mechanisms of VPNs in Protecting Online Privacy
Virtual Private Networks (VPNs) are essential tools for enhancing online privacy by creating a secure and encrypted connection between your device and the internet. When a user connects to a VPN, their internet traffic is routed through a secure server, effectively masking their IP address. This process obscures the user’s location and identity, making it significantly more difficult for third parties, such as hackers or data brokers, to monitor online activities. Key mechanisms involved in this protection include:
- Encryption: VPNs encrypt data transmitted over the internet, scrambling it to prevent unauthorized access.
- Tunneling protocols: VPNs utilize various tunneling protocols (such as OpenVPN, L2TP/IPsec) to establish a secure connection, enhancing data integrity.
- IP Masking: By replacing the user’s real IP address with that of the VPN server, it becomes nearly impossible for websites and online services to track individual users.
Additionally, many VPNs come equipped with features that bolster privacy even further. One such feature is a kill switch, which disconnects the internet if the VPN connection drops, ensuring that sensitive data is never exposed. Moreover, reputable VPN services have strict no-logs policies, meaning they do not retain information about user activities. This commitment to user anonymity is vital in today’s digital age, where data breaches are rampant, and personal information is often exploited. Choosing the Right VPN: Key Features to Look for in a Privacy Solution
When selecting a VPN, it’s crucial to evaluate several essential features that can significantly enhance your online privacy and security. Start by examining the encryption protocols offered; look for those that utilize strong encryption standards like AES-256. Additionally, a reliable VPN should provide a no-logs policy, ensuring that your browsing activity is not stored or tracked. It’s also beneficial if the service includes DNS leak protection, which prevents your ISP from seeing your internet traffic even when you’re connected to the VPN. Furthermore, consider the availability of multi-device support, allowing you to secure multiple devices simultaneously without sacrificing performance.
Another aspect to think about is the server network. A broader range of servers often translates to better speeds and a greater chance of finding an optimal connection point. Check if the VPN offers a kill switch feature, which automatically disconnects your internet if the VPN connection drops, preventing accidental exposure of your data. Best Practices for Using VPNs to Enhance Your Online Security
Utilizing a VPN effectively involves making informed choices that align with your specific online activities. Select a reputable provider that prioritizes privacy and security features like a no-log policy and strong encryption protocols. Consider using a VPN with a user-friendly interface, making it easy for anyone to connect to secure servers without hassle. Additionally, enable DNS leak protection to ensure your web traffic remains hidden from prying eyes. Regularly updating your VPN software is crucial, as these updates often include important security enhancements to guard against emerging threats.
Furthermore, customize your VPN settings for optimal protection based on your usage. For instance, activate the kill switch feature that automatically disconnects your internet if the VPN connection drops, preventing unprotected access. Make a point of connecting to servers in regions with strong privacy laws to enhance your anonymity online. Avoid free VPN services that may compromise your data or inject ads, opting instead for premium solutions that invest in user security. Consider creating a security checklist for your VPN usage, which can include:
- Ensure your VPN is activated before browsing.
- Regularly verify your IP and DNS leak status.
- Use multi-factor authentication where possible.
